pub struct PrivateKey(pub StaticSecret);
Expand description

A CBOR serializable Diffie-Hellman X25519 private key.

Tuple Fields§

§0: StaticSecret

Implementations§

source§

impl PrivateKey

source

pub fn generate() -> Self

Generate a new private key.

source

pub fn public_key(&self) -> PublicKey

Compute corresponding public key.

source

pub fn from_test_seed(seed: String) -> Self

Generate a new private key from a test key seed.
